Your company's stock sells for $38 per share, the next dividend (D1) will be $2.9, its growth rate is a constant 6 percent, and the company will incur a flotation cost of 11 percent if it sells new common stock. What is the firm's cost of new equity, re? 16.57% 15.57% 14.57% 13.57% 12.57%
